set about
英 [set əˈbaʊt]
美 [set əˈbaʊt]
动手; 开始; 下手; 着手
英英释义
verb
- take the first step or steps in carrying out an action
- We began working at dawn
- Who will start?
- Get working as soon as the sun rises!
- The first tourists began to arrive in Cambodia
- He began early in the day
- Let's get down to work now
- enter upon an activity or enterprise
- begin to deal with
- approach a task
- go about a difficult problem
- approach a new project
